📦 트루나스(TrueNAS)의 장단점 완벽 정리
📌 트루나스(TrueNAS)란 무엇인가?
트루나스(TrueNAS)는 오픈소스 기반의 NAS(Network Attached Storage) 운영체제로, 개인 사용자부터 기업 환경까지 폭넓게 활용되는 데이터 저장 및 관리 솔루션이다. 단순한 파일 저장 장치를 넘어 데이터 보호, 백업, 공유, 그리고 가상화 기능까지 제공하며, 안정성과 확장성 측면에서 매우 높은 평가를 받고 있다.
특히 트루나스는 ZFS 파일 시스템을 기반으로 동작하는데, 이는 일반적인 파일 시스템보다 훨씬 강력한 데이터 보호 기능을 제공한다는 점에서 큰 특징을 가진다. 이러한 이유로 중요한 데이터를 안전하게 관리해야 하는 사용자들에게 매우 적합한 선택지로 꼽힌다.
✅ 트루나스의 장점
트루나스의 가장 큰 장점은 단연 데이터 안정성이다. ZFS 파일 시스템은 데이터 무결성을 자동으로 검증하며, 파일이 손상되었을 경우 이를 감지하고 복구할 수 있는 기능을 제공한다. 또한 스냅샷 기능을 통해 특정 시점의 데이터를 그대로 보존할 수 있어, 실수로 파일을 삭제하거나 문제가 발생했을 때 빠르게 이전 상태로 되돌릴 수 있다. 이러한 기능은 개인 사용자뿐만 아니라 기업 환경에서도 매우 중요한 요소로 작용한다.
또 하나 주목할 점은 트루나스가 무료 오픈소스라는 점이다. 일반적인 NAS 솔루션은 라이선스 비용이나 구독료가 발생하는 경우가 많지만, 트루나스는 별도의 비용 없이도 강력한 기능을 사용할 수 있다. 이는 개인이 직접 NAS 서버를 구축하려는 경우 매우 큰 장점으로 작용한다.
기능적인 측면에서도 트루나스는 단순한 저장 장치를 넘어선다. SMB, NFS, FTP 등 다양한 프로토콜을 지원하여 여러 환경에서 파일 공유가 가능하며, 가상 머신이나 컨테이너를 실행할 수 있는 기능도 제공한다. 이를 통해 하나의 서버에서 여러 역할을 동시에 수행할 수 있어 활용도가 매우 높다.
확장성 또한 트루나스의 중요한 장점 중 하나다. 하드디스크를 추가하여 저장 용량을 확장할 수 있으며, RAID 구성을 통해 성능과 안정성을 동시에 확보할 수 있다. 데이터가 지속적으로 증가하는 환경에서도 유연하게 대응할 수 있다는 점에서 장기적인 사용에 적합하다.
마지막으로 웹 기반 관리 인터페이스를 제공한다는 점도 큰 장점이다. 복잡한 명령어를 입력하지 않아도 웹 브라우저를 통해 대부분의 설정과 관리를 수행할 수 있어 비교적 직관적인 운영이 가능하다. 서버 운영 경험이 많지 않은 사용자라도 기본적인 사용은 충분히 익힐 수 있다.
❌ 트루나스의 단점
하지만 트루나스가 완벽한 솔루션은 아니다. 가장 먼저 고려해야 할 점은 하드웨어 요구사항이다. 트루나스는 안정적인 운영을 위해 최소 8GB 이상의 RAM을 권장하며, 가능하다면 ECC 메모리를 사용하는 것이 좋다. 이는 일반적인 가정용 PC 환경에서는 다소 부담이 될 수 있다.
초기 설정 난이도 역시 단점으로 꼽힌다. 웹 인터페이스가 제공되긴 하지만, 스토리지 구성이나 네트워크 설정, 그리고 ZFS 구조에 대한 기본적인 이해가 필요하다. 완전히 처음 서버를 접하는 사용자에게는 다소 진입 장벽이 있을 수 있다.
또한 ZFS의 특성상 저장소 확장 방식에 제약이 있다는 점도 주의해야 한다. 일반적인 RAID 구성과 달리 디스크를 자유롭게 추가하거나 변경하기 어려운 경우가 있어, 초기 설계 단계에서 충분한 계획이 필요하다. 잘못 구성할 경우 이후 확장이 번거로워질 수 있다.
전력 소모 역시 무시할 수 없는 요소다. 트루나스는 항상 켜져 있는 서버 형태로 운영되는 경우가 많기 때문에, 장기간 사용 시 전기 요금이 증가할 수 있다. 특히 여러 개의 하드디스크를 사용하는 경우 그 영향은 더욱 커진다.
마지막으로 일부 고급 기능은 기업 환경을 기준으로 설계되어 있어 일반 사용자에게는 다소 복잡하게 느껴질 수 있다. TrueNAS CORE와 SCALE 중 어떤 버전을 선택해야 하는지에 대한 고민도 필요하며, 각 기능을 제대로 활용하려면 추가적인 학습이 요구된다.
📝 마무리
트루나스는 단순한 NAS를 넘어 데이터 보호와 확장성을 모두 갖춘 강력한 저장 솔루션이다. 무료 오픈소스임에도 불구하고 기업 수준의 기능을 제공한다는 점은 매우 큰 매력이다. 특히 중요한 데이터를 안전하게 보관하고, 다양한 방식으로 활용하고자 하는 사용자에게는 매우 적합한 선택이 될 수 있다.
다만, 높은 하드웨어 요구사항과 초기 설정의 난이도, 그리고 ZFS 특유의 구조적 제약은 반드시 고려해야 할 요소다. 따라서 트루나스를 도입하기 전에는 자신의 사용 목적과 환경을 충분히 검토하는 것이 중요하다.
결론적으로 트루나스는 “조금 배우더라도 강력한 NAS를 쓰고 싶은 사용자”에게 최고의 선택이 될 수 있으며, 제대로 구축한다면 오랫동안 안정적으로 사용할 수 있는 훌륭한 시스템이라 할 수 있다.
